What tools and technologies will I Learn?
Manual Testing: JIRA, TestRail, Selenium IDE, browser dev tools. Automation: Selenium WebDriver, Python, Git, Jenkins, TestNG. API Testing: Postman, REST Assured, GraphQL, API security tools. Plus soft skills like test planning, documentation, and agile methodologies. …
